Cellular

So many advances have been made in the cellular industry. From the types of phones we use to the types of sound waves our calls are carried on. From analog to digital, from phones the size of bricks to ones as small as your pinkie, cellular technology has come a long way.

The first cell phones were huge and bulky and surprisingly, status symbols. Having a cell phone meant wealth. They were largely used by the wealthy when first introduced but now you are hard pressed to find anyone without one. There are some older generation people that don't have them but it's because they don't want to learn or be bothered. These types are usually still writing checks and paying bills through the mail. The new generations have picked up on cellular technology and always wait anxiously to see what type of device will come out next.

Cell phones and cellular technology have become such a huge part of life that no one really has a house phone or land line any longer. They are unnecessary. Cell phones are the number one way to get a hold of someone these days. Whether you text or call, cell phones have made a huge impact on society. The younger generations are texting professionals and now laws are being passed to keep everyone safe while diving and talking on your phone. Maybe cellular technology is a good thing but like all good things, it has a time and place.

The Toyota type A engine was produced during the years of 1935 throughout 1947 and was considered a straight-6 engine. Although there are not many of these cars left still on the road, parts can still be had for them in order to revive them. The Type B engine carried Toyota through the years 1937-1955 as a more technically advanced version of the A. Type C and E were produced during that time as well but was built removing two of the cylinders.

Finally in 1947, they created the Type S engine that was brand new, unlike the predecessors, which were based off of other engines from other manufacturers. It was produced until 1959.

Toyota engine parts have evolved greatly and moved into the Flat-twin which started in 1961 and lasted up through 1976 with versions 697 cc U, 790- cc2U and 790 cc 2U-B. The Straight 3 was introduced in 2004 which then gave way to the V6 engine and the V8 engine. The V10 was then soon to follow - although the V12 was produced in 1997 about 13 years earlier.
